In the remote foothills of Morocco's Middle Atlas mountains lies the fabled city of Fes, an ancient beehive of winding streets and lost alleyways pulsing to a rhythm untouched by the centuries. Once a year, for one unforgettable week, Fes opens its gates to host its acclaimed Festival of World Sacred Music. Under the Moroccan Sky ushers listeners into this intoxicating alchemy of ecstatic music from across the globe.
Ten tracks, capturing the very best of the festival's 1999 and 2000 seasons, include the spectacular rhythms and voices of Egypt and Algeria, heartfelt Sufi songs of West Africa, spiraling Qaderi Dervish music from Kurdistan, Spanish gypsy songs from the Old World, and more.
For anyone yearning to hear sacred world music at its very highest level, Under the Moroccan Sky offers a magic carpet ride to the far reaches of this enchanted and eternal domain.
Featured artists: Aruna Sairam (India); Houria Aichi (Algeria); Ensemble Ibn Arabi (Morocco); Musa Dieng Kala (Senegal); Dufay Collective (United Kingdom); Tekameli (France); Nass El Ghiwane (Morocco); Qaderi Dervishes of Kurdistan.
